Camembert; Country of origin: France: Region, town: Normandy, Camembert: Source of milk: Cows: Pasteurized: Not traditionally: Texture: Soft-ripened: Aging time: At least 3 weeks: Certification: Camembert de Normandie AOC 1983, PDO 1992: Named after: Camembert: Related media on Commons See more Camembert is a moist, soft, creamy, surface-ripened cow's milk cheese. It was first made in the late 18th century in Camembert, Normandy, in northwest France. It is sometimes compared in look and taste to See more Camembert cheese gets its characteristic odor from many compounds. These include diacetyl (buttery flavoring for popcorn), 3-methylbutanal, methional (degradation … See more Typically camembert tends to be sold whole in thin, round, wooden containers made from poplar. You can read the first chapter … buckeye care and rehab nursing homeCamembert was reputedly first made in 1791 by Marie Harel, a farmer from Normandy, following advice from a priest who came from Brie. She is credited with having refined a previously existing cheese recipe from the Pays d'Auge region and having launched it into the wider world.
